649 DTG is a 2008 Jaguar Xjr in Black with a 4,196c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 82.4%.
Across all 2008 Jaguar Xjr models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.7% with a typical mileage of 61,934 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Jaguar Xjr f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 3,708 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 649 DTG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jaguar Xjr typ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 18 years old, this Jaguar Xjr is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
